This Log Cabin has spectacular views of surrounding mountains, and the screened-in back porch is like being in a treehouse within the protected Chattahoochee-Oconee National Forest, located directly below and behind the Log Cabin. It was custom-built in 1994 from 150-year-old hand-notched Cypress logs (it was not made from a kit). It has hand-made cypress cabinetry; its decor includes many antiques and curios; and it sleeps up to 6. Please note that the quoted price is for 2 guests, with a $10 per night additional guest fee, for each person beyond the first two. Our Log Cabin has three bedrooms (the ground-floor primary bedroom with a queen-size bed, luxury 100% cotton linens and duvet, a second-floor loft bedroom with double bed with luxury cotton linens and duvet, and a separate second-floor bedroom with two twin XL beds), and there is also a very comfy queen sleeper-sofa with a memory foam topper for your convenience, along with two full bathrooms with showers—one on each floor). We also recently upgraded all beds with new luxury memory foam mattresses, for the coziest sleep ever.
Please be aware that our beloved Log Cabin was built in a traditional 1800s style, with several steps to enter the first floor, and a staircase to reach the second floor, so mobility/wheelchair-accessibility is not possible.
That said, don't let the authentic period architecture, country decor, or antiques fool you. Every amenity is provided, including free WiFi, DIRECTV STREAM channels, Roku for streaming apps, Blu-Ray/DVD, luxury cotton linens and towels, dishes, a fully equipped kitchen and dining room, luxury bathroom amenities, washer and dryer, central heat and air and a warm gas-powered fireplace (for both beauty and heat).
Most everyone loves settling into a porch-swing or rocker to find deep serenity on the full-length/screened-in balcony overlooking the forest and nearby mountains, typically accompanied only by the soft sounds of wind in the trees and the birds of the forest. We see deer families visiting frequently below.
For dining out, downtown Blairsville is in the valley below, only a few minutes drive away; and there is a plethora of nearby restaurants ranging from fine dining to down-home country cookin'; and there is even a local whiskey distillery, with tours!
Nearby you will find Vogel State Park, the Appalachian Trail, and countless waterfalls, along with trout fishing, boating, kayaking, golf — and if you like whitewater rafting (we like Wildwater Rafting Company as guides), the cabin is almost directly between the Chattooga and Ocoee rivers (each is only about an hour’s drive away). Sightseers will love nearby Helen, Georgia or a day trip to Cashiers-Highland, NC. The kids will delight in finding gold or gems in the mines which are a short and scenic drive away.
Although there are many activities nearby, most guests love the peaceful sanctuary that the Log Cabin is, in its secluded location on top of a mountain — yet still only a few minutes drive from Walmart and Blairsville’s Town Square.
